Features And Specs Comparison: Playbar Vs. Arc

When comparing the features and specifications of the Sonos Playbar and the Sonos Arc, several key differences come to light. The Playbar offers a traditional soundbar design with nine amplified speakers, delivering crisp and clear sound quality for an immersive home theater experience. On the other hand, the Arc boasts eleven high-performance drivers, including upward-firing speakers for a more enveloping soundstage and Dolby Atmos support, creating a more dynamic and three-dimensional audio experience.

In terms of connectivity, both the Playbar and Arc offer Wi-Fi streaming capabilities, allowing you to easily stream music and other audio content from various online sources. However, the Arc takes it a step further with HDMI eARC support, enabling high-quality audio passthrough from compatible TVs for enhanced sound clarity and synchronization. Additionally, the Arc features Trueplay tuning technology, automatically adapting the sound profile based on your room’s acoustics for optimal performance, while the Playbar requires manual tuning.

Overall, while the Sonos Playbar remains a solid choice for improving your TV’s audio quality, the Sonos Arc represents a significant upgrade with its advanced features, including Dolby Atmos support, HDMI eARC connectivity, and Trueplay tuning technology, making it a worthwhile investment for those seeking the ultimate sound experience.

Immersive Audio Experience: Dolby Atmos On The Arc

The Sonos Arc provides an unparalleled immersive audio experience with its enhanced capabilities, including support for Dolby Atmos technology. Dolby Atmos takes traditional surround sound to the next level by creating a three-dimensional audio environment that envelops the listener from every angle. With the Arc, you can expect sound to move around you in a lifelike manner, heightening the sense of realism in movies, music, and games.

This technology is achieved through advanced signal processing and upward-firing speakers that bounce sound off the ceiling to simulate overhead audio effects. Smart Features And Connectivity

When it comes to smart features and connectivity, the Sonos Arc truly shines compared to the Playbar. The Arc is equipped with voice control capabilities through built-in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ant, providing a hands-free experience for controlling your audio environment. Additionally, the Arc supports Apple AirPlay 2, allowing seamless integration with your Apple devices for easy streaming and control.

In terms of connectivity, the Sonos Arc offers HDMI eARC compatibility, enabling high-quality audio transmission from your TV to the soundbar. This feature ensures that you can enjoy immersive sound without any loss of audio quality. Furthermore, the Arc supports Wi-Fi connectivity, allowing you to easily stream music and other audio content from various online platforms with a stable and reliable connection.

Setting Up The Arc In Your Home Theater

When setting up the Arc in your home theater, it is essential to choose the ideal placement to maximize its performance. Position the Arc directly in front of the viewing area, whether mounted on the wall or placed on a media console. Ensure there are no obstructions blocking the soundwaves for optimal audio dispersion throughout the room.

For a more immersive experience, consider pairing the Arc with Sonos Sub and Sonos One SL speakers for a true surround sound setup. The Sonos app provides step-by-step instructions to effortlessly integrate the Arc with other Sonos devices in your home network. Fine-tune the audio settings through the app to customize the sound profile based on your preferences and room acoustics.

What Are The Key Differences Between Sonos Playbar And Arc?

The key differences between Sonos Playbar and Arc lie in their audio technology and connectivity. The Playbar offers a virtual surround sound experience while the Arc features Dolby Atmos for a more immersive audio experience with overhead sound effects. Additionally, the Arc has built-in voice control compatibility and supports HDMI connectivity, whereas the Playbar relies on optical input and lacks voice assistant integration. Overall, the Arc provides more advanced features and modern connectivity options compared to the Playbar.
